Description
Tender carrots and crisp-tender green beans roasted with a glossy honey-balsamic glaze, garlic, and thyme. A colorful, cozy side that’s quick enough for weeknights and special enough for holidays.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b carrots, peeled and cut on a diagonal into 1-inch pieces (or baby carrots, halved if thick)
- 1 lb fresh green beans, trimmed
- 3 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
- 3 tbsp honey (or maple syrup)
- 2 tbsp balsamic vinegar
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tsp dried thyme (or 1 tbsp fresh)
- Kosher salt and black pepper, to taste
- Optional: chopped parsley or toasted sesame seeds
Instructions
- Preheat: Heat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ment.
- Make glaze: Whisk olive oil, honey, balsamic, garlic, thyme, salt, and pepper until glossy.
- Coat veggies: Toss carrots and green beans with the glaze until evenly coated.
- Roast: Spread in a single layer; roast 20–25 minutes, tossing once, until carrots are tender and beans are bright with a slight snap. Broil 1–2 minutes for extra caramelization if desired.
- Serve: Rest 1–2 minutes so the glaze clings, then garnish with parsley or sesame seeds.
Notes
For vegan, use maple syrup. Add red pepper flakes for heat. Don’t overcrowd the pan—space promotes caramelization. Reheat gently on a sheet pan to keep the glaze glossy.
